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 500, here are decompositions:

  • 13 + 487 = 500
  • 37 + 463 = 500
  • 43 + 457 = 500
  • 61 + 439 = 500
  • 67 + 433 = 500
  • 79 + 421 = 500
  • 103 + 397 = 500
  • 127 + 373 = 500

Showing the first eight; more decompositions exist.
